Do you think its okay to take both at the same time? (OLE & GSE) at the same time?

I'm also trying to fight Babesia!!

Right now - I take (SEAGATE) OLE � 450mg pills. 100% pure, no fillers.

The bottle says>

Maintenance level - take 2 to 4 caps/day
Additional Support � take 4 to 9 caps/day

If I took 9 that would be (4050)MG. per/day that sounds like its way to much???

Hi Steve
Both are anti-viral and anti-bacterial, each working via different mechanisms. Pairing them up should be not a problem at all, in fact herbal studies show that it's best to work with herbs in clusters rather than singly.*

That said, you might find that die-off symptoms could be rather pronounced with both of them together. I would suggest starting with the olive leaf extract (very effective yet gentler than the GSE) then adding the GSE later. Go slowly, to test for your own individualized response.*

Hi Randibear
I would follow the directions on the bottle. However, to be sure that you are not herxing or are tolerating the treatment well, I would suggest starting very slowly and gradually creeping the dosage up. GSE is very strong, I would start wiht 1 drop in a cup of water per day and then increase very gradually over a period of 1-2 weeks. If you are as sensitive as I am, you can even start with 1 drop every other day. this will not be therapeutic per se, but instead will get your body acclimated. If you are sensitive, that is.

If you are of a hardy constitution, you can probably start with the full dosage. I think it's wise to go slowly however just to test the waters.

Be sure to report any herx and other symptoms to your doctor for his/her discernment. THis is very important. Also be sure s/he knows you are doing this before starting it, in case something is contra-indicated in your own unique case.
